Progressive pulmonary fibrosis due to diffuse alveolar damage in a COVID‐19‐infected autopsy case
We encountered a patient with severe co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ID‐19)‐related pneumonia, who died of progressive respiratory acidosis after 2 months of treatment with mechanical ventilation.
